On The Net
Level 2 Riverside Quay 1 Southbank Boulevard, Southbank, VIC 3006
On The Net offers online backup services including online data storage, cloud backup, and offsite backup. We are a leading online backup Australia company and we pride ourselves in offering cost-effective data storage services to our clients
5 out of 5 from 1 reviews